Frequently Asked Questions about San Jose
How much are Studio apartments in San Jose?
There are currently 3,537 Studio Apartments in San Jose with rent ranges from $972 to $4,424 with an average price of $2,804.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om San Jose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in San Jose ranges from $1,000 to $21,571 with an average monthly rent of $3,555.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in San Jose c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in San Jose range from $995 to $23,267.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$4,373.
How expensive are San Jose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 1,725 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in San Jose on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,460 to $13,430 - averaging $5,256 for the location.
